In fact, there are two technical routes for digital cameras.

One is a CMOS camera.

Another type is the CCD camera.

CMOS stands for "Complementary Metal Oxide Semiconductor", which is essentially a large-scale integrated circuit chip.

CMOS cameras capture images using a CMOS sensor, reading pixel data in a progressive scan manner.

It has fast reading speed and low power consumption. It can use semiconductor manufacturing processes and can be integrated with other circuit chips.

The full name of CCD is charge-coupled device. It is also a semiconductor chip used to capture images. It reads pixel data through charge transfer.

However, CCD sensors require specialized manufacturing processes and are more expensive than CMOS.

However, CCD has an advantage: because it uses charge transfer, its resolution is relatively high and there is less noise.

However, if the design and manufacturing technology of CMOS are greatly improved, then the shortcomings of CMOS will become less and less, even in terms of resolution and noise, it will not be worse than CCD. In this case, the era of CMOS dominance has arrived. .

At the very least, in the previous life, by the 21s, even those so-called professional SLR digital cameras almost all used CMOS sensors, and CCDs had been eliminated.
